What Is A Professional Dishwasher?

WHAT IS A PROFESSIONAL DISHWASHER?

A professional dishwasher is someone who is employed in the food industry, like in a restaurant, hotel, or fine dining experience, to wash the dirty dishes in the kitchen. It may sound mundane, but businesses in the food industry put a great deal of trust in their dishwashers because of the vital role they play in the business.

DO DISHWASHERS GET TRAINING?

Whilst you don’t need a formal degree or certificate to get a dishwashing job, you will need to spend a few hours learning what the job entails and getting on-hand training before you can become one. Dishwasher training usually means shadowing another dishwasher for a few hours to learn the ropes, and to learn how the business wants things done. You would begin as a junior and then work your way up into a more senior position with more responsibility, in most cases.

5 SKILLS EVERY PROFESSIONAL DISHWASHER NEEDS

At Unilever Professional, we deal with many different kinds of businesses in the foodservice industry. All of our customers have a high standard of hygiene, professionalism, and service delivery as their core values. To work in this industry as a pro dishwasher, here are the five most important skills to have:

  • Professionalism - even though you are based in the kitchen, you still need to maintain a high level of professionalism because your job is essential to the overall professionalism of the business.
  • Attention to detail - this is key because your role is vital in ensuring the dishes of a restaurant or hotel are immaculately clean and that every scrap of dirt is gone.
  • Physical stamina - being a dishwasher is a physically taxing job because you are required to work on your feet and move around constantly for your entire shift - which can last up to 8 hours.
  • Verbal communication - good communication skills are essential in any professional position. You need to be able to communicate easily about what you are doing, how others need to assist you, and what expectations are of you and your team.
  • Customer service - although you may not be customer-facing in this role, you still need excellent communication skills because you are a part of delivery an excellent service to patrons from start to finish.

TOP TIPS FOR PROFESSIONAL DISHWASHERS

  • Never use your phone or text while washing dishes - it's unprofessional and you risk dropping your device into a sink full of water.
  • Always wear appropriate and professional clothing, to adhere to health and safety standards and to keep yourself safe too.
  • Make sure your personal hygiene and hand hygiene is immaculate.
